DESCRIPTION

The Huke washing station receives cherries from more than 600 growers around the Gotiti

kebele. The washed processed coffees are depulped within 8 hours after picking and the

mucilage-covered parchment is submerged in water for a 36 to 48 hour fermentation,

depending on the conditions. After most of the mucilage is consumed, the coffee is fully

washed in canals with running water until the water is completely transparent and all of the

mucilage is completely removed from the parchment.

After fermenting and washing, this premium coffee is laid out on raised beds under a shade

net for 5 to 7 days until the moisture content is between 11 and 12%. The coffee is then moved

inside a nearby warehouse for final homogenization and resting until it is ready to be

transported to the dry mill.

The Huke washing station is owned by Testi Trading and operated by the Yonis family and

their team. We have had the pleasure of buying coffees from Faysel Yonis since 2015 and the

coffee never disappoints! Testi Trading makes significant investments in the communities that

they operate in through their Project Direct initiatives. So far they have completed

construction of multiple primary schools and even the first ever high school in the town of

Hamasho, a small town in Sidama.
